Vista sli drivers have been out for a while.

The most current are these. http://www.nvidia.com/object/winvista_x86_158.18.html

Supports 6/7/8 series dx9 and open gl sli, but no dx10 sli yet.

I haven't tried sli on vista so I don't know how buggy it is.

I have gone back to XP after being a fool and trying Vista nice and early. With a GeForce 7 series SLi setup i would get scores of around 4500 with 3dMark05 and with XP i get the full 7600 as expected from my cards. The Vista ForceWare drivers that support may make the system run (fairly) stable but they just don't give you the performance the cards deserve.

This, the Media Centre playing up and the Samsung MagicTune software crashing my system are the reasons I went back to XP but on the whole Vista is a nice package that will (hopefully) be a great package after SP1
